WebNormal Values For Creatinine Pregnancy. perinatology.com Reference Values During Pregnancy: Home > Reference > Reference Values > Creatinine. Creatinine (serum, plasma) Units: Nonpregnant Female: First Trimester: Second Trimester: Third Trimester: mg/dL: 0.5 - 0.9: 0.4 - 0.7: 0.4 - 0.8: 0.4 - 0.9: µmol/L: 44 - 80: 35 - 62: 35 - 71 ... WebDuring pregnancy, due to the increased renal blood flow, some additional protein may be lost in the urine. This increased protein loss should not normally be in quantities exceeding 300 mg in 24 hours. If more than 300 mg in 24 hours is found, this may signal the development of pre-eclampsia.
